Get to Know the Team
You will be joining the Metadata & BI Platforms team within Grab's Data Engineering Platforms department. The team builds and maintains the systems that power Grab's data intelligence: Hubble (data discovery platform), Genchi (data observability platform), Superset and Power BI (business intelligence platforms), and the Data Agent (agentic analytics platform).
We work at the intersection of data engineering and AI, building systems that help thousands of internal users across Grab discover, understand, and act on data. The team is passionate about applying the latest AI advances to make data more accessible, intelligent, and useful at scale.
Get to Know the Role
As an AI Engineer Intern, you will contribute to building and improving AI-powered data platforms that make data discovery, observability, and analytics smarter and more intuitive at Grab. You will get hands-on experience building production-grade systems — from LLM integrations and agentic workflows to vector search pipelines — alongside engineers who ship AI features at scale.
This is a high-impact role where your contributions will be used by real internal users across the company. You will work in a fast-paced, collaborative environment with mentorship from experienced engineers, gaining exposure to the full AI product development lifecycle from design to deployment.
The Critical Tasks You Will Perform
- You will design and implement backend services and APIs that support AI-driven data platform features.
- You will integrate LLM APIs into platform workflows to enable intelligent automation and natural-language capabilities.
- You will contribute to building and orchestrating agentic systems (e.g., using LangGraph) for use cases such as data troubleshooting, SQL/code generation, and data Q&A.
- You will develop and optimize vector search and RAG pipelines to improve data retrieval and semantic understanding.
- You will debug and resolve performance or reliability issues in complex data systems, working toward production readiness.
- You will Collaborate with product managers, data engineers, and data analysts to deliver high-impact features.
